ORDER

The Writ petition has been filed for issuance of a Writ of Mandamus, directing the 3rd respondent to dispose of the representation of the petitioner dated 22.11.2014, seeking to enter the name of one late Jambulingam Chettiar as legal heir in the revenue accounts in respect of properties situate at 173/1B1, Melaseedevi Mangalam Village, Manachanallur Taluk, Trichy District.

2.Mr.S.Kumar, learned Additional Government Pleader took notice for the respondents 1 to 4. By consent, the Writ petition itself is taken up for final disposal.

3.The learned counsel appearing for the petitioner would submit that it would be suffice, if the representation of the petitioner dated 22.11.2014 is disposed of, on merits and in accordance with law.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

4.The learned Additional Government Pleader appearing for the respondents 1 to 4 would submit that the representation of the petitioner will be considered in accordance with law and on merits. 5.In view of the above, without going into the merits of the claim made by the petitioner in this Writ Petition, the 3rd respondent is directed to pass appropriate orders on the representation of the petitioner, dated 22.11.2014, on merits and in accordance with law, after giving notice to the respondents 5 to 8 and also other necessary parties, if any, within a period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

With the above direction, this Writ Petition stands disposed of. No costs.
